Clifford Chance (CC) is facing a professional negligence claim from litigation funders over its work on the high-profile Excalibur Ventures dispute.

Excalibur hired CC to act for it on a high-profile $1.6bn claim against Texas Keystone and Gulf Keystone over petroleum interests in Iraqi Kurdistan. The claim was dismissed last autumn, with Lord Justice Christopher Clarke awarding the defendants costs on an indemnity basis in October, making four groups of third-party funders collectively liable for over £23m.
